Transaction 9277918306303e54dc4f84cec5a1064f47bae20e8d769a62075fc1033418c0ec
1 Input
1 Output
-
9277918306303e54dc4f84cec5a1064f47bae20e8d769a62075fc1033418c0ec:0
- value
- 138313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1cdf497d269fc555d7649261b0c6a2143e5cc00 OP_EQUAL
- address
- 3LpMsftPtsgSxUWLS6hVvxHh3RGymp7xP9